Senior Frontend Developer (Angular +19)

BlackStone eIT · Cairo, Egypt · Posted 2026-05-14

BlackStone eIT is seeking an experienced Senior Frontend Developer specializing in Angular version 19 or higher to join our innovative development team. In this role, you will be responsible for designing, developing, and maintaining high-quality, scalable web applications using the latest Angular technologies.You will collaborate closely with UI/UX designers, backend developers, and product managers to deliver seamless and engaging user interfaces that meet business requirements. Your expertise in Angular and frontend technologies will be critical in enhancing application performance, scalability, and accessibility.ResponsibilitiesDevelop and maintain complex web applications using Angular 19 and related frontend technologiesTranslate UI/UX designs into efficient and responsive user interfacesCollaborate with cross-functional teams to define, design, and ship new featuresEnsure code quality through code reviews, unit testing, and best practicesIdentify and optimize application performance bottlenecksProvide technical leadership and mentorship to junior developersStay updated with latest advancements in Angular and frontend development trendsRequirementsBachelor's degree in Computer Science, Software Engineering, or related fieldMinimum of 5 years of professional experience in frontend developmentProven expertise in Angular 19+ with strong knowledge of TypeScript, HTML5, CSS3, and JavaScriptExperience with state management libraries such as NgRx or RxJSFamiliarity with RESTful APIs, version control systems (Git), and agile methodologiesStrong understanding of responsive design, cross-browser compatibility, and performance optimizationExperience with testing frameworks such as Jasmine, Karma, or CypressExcellent communication, problem-solving, and teamwork skillsAbility to mentor and guide junior developers effectivelyBenefits💵 Competitive salary paid in USD🏡 Fully remote - work from anywhere🌎 Work with a diverse international team🚀 Exciting projects and a supportive engineering culture📈 Opportunities to grow technically and professionally

Apply for this role